What is a listing video?
A listing video is a short marketing film of a home for sale, used on the MLS, social media, and an agent's own channels. It usually runs 30 seconds to 3 minutes and mixes interior walkthrough shots, exterior and drone views, and neighborhood context. The job of the video is to make the right buyers want to see the home in person.

In NYC, a real estate listing video runs from about $150 for an animated photo reel to $1,000 for a cinematic video with the agent on camera. Most standard sale listings land between $300 and $700. Price is driven by whether the agent is on camera, the length and number of shots, whether drone is included, and the size of the home.
